The artist has employed shading to model the form, emphasizing the curves of the torso, breasts, and thighs. The musculature is clearly defined, indicating a deliberate study of human anatomy. There’s a sense of movement captured in the flowing lines that trace the contours of her body; the posture implies an upward surge, a reaching towards something beyond the frame.
The figures face, though rendered with less detail than the rest of the body, conveys a sense of earnestness or longing. The eyes are directed upwards, reinforcing the impression of aspiration. A subtle expression of vulnerability is present in her features.
The drawing is contained within a rectangular border, which serves to isolate the figure and direct the viewers attention solely on her form and gesture. The background is plain, devoid of any contextual elements that might provide narrative clues. This stark simplicity amplifies the emotional impact of the pose and emphasizes the subject’s solitary nature.
Subtly, there’s a sense of fragility conveyed by the delicate lines used to depict the figure. Despite the anatomical accuracy and implied strength, the overall impression is one of vulnerability and yearning. The upward gaze and outstretched hands suggest a desire for connection or redemption, hinting at themes of hope, faith, or perhaps even despair.
